Nathalie Giannitrapani, known simply as Nathalie, is an Italian singer-songwriter. Born in Rome in 1978, she rose to prominence in the 1990s with a pop-rock sound influenced by artists like Alanis Morissette and Sheryl Crow. Her debut album, "Nathalie", was released in 1996 and included the hit single "Don't Say Goodbye". Throughout her career, she has released other albums, including "Without Fear" (2000) and "Love is a Game" (2003), earning recognition and appreciation from audiences. Nathalie is known for her catchy melodies, introspective lyrics, and powerful and versatile voice. Some of her most representative songs include "Don't Say Goodbye", "Without Fear", and "Love is a Game".
